NCT ID: NCT02534675 Completed - Cancer Clinical Trials

Study of Molecular Profile-Related Evidence to Determine Individualized Therapy for Advanced or Poor Prognosis Cancers

I-PREDICT
Start date: February 2015
Phase:
Study type: Observational

The purpose of this study is to learn more about personalized cancer therapy including response to treatment and side effects. Information from the patient's medical record regarding the tests and treatments they have received, or will receive, for their cancer will be collected. Genomic testing on tissue from the primary tumor or metastases will be used to match therapy recommendations. Patients in which there is no appropriate matched therapy will receive systemic chemotherapy according to their treating physician's discretion. This information will be used to describe whether or not patients respond better when their physicians choose to treat them according to the genetic makeup of their tumor.

NCT ID: NCT02501460 Completed - Cancer Clinical Trials

Impact of Resistance Training-Protein Supplementation on Lean Muscle Mass in Childhood Cancer Survivors

Start date: August 17, 2015
Phase: N/A
Study type: Interventional

This study is being conducted because low lean muscle mass is prevalent among childhood cancer survivors. Lean muscle is the non-fatty muscle tissue that makes up part of the body's lean body mass. Low lean muscle mass is associated with loss of overall body strength, declining mobility and eventually, loss of independence. Among childhood cancer survivors, low lean muscle mass may contribute to reduced physical functioning and a sense of fatigue with exertion, limiting ability to participate in adequate physical activity. Loss of strength and a sense of fatigue with repeated movement make it difficult to participate in daily activities. Although there have not been exercise intervention studies among childhood cancer survivors specifically designed to evaluate the effects of resistance training on muscle mass, studies among individuals with chronic disease, including survivors of adult onset cancers, indicate that resistance exercise improves muscle mass, muscle strength, mobility, vitality and physical activity levels. Resistance training (weight lifting) is a form of physical activity that is designed to improve muscular fitness by exercising a muscle or a muscle group against external resistance. The purpose of the study is to evaluate the effects of resistance training combined with either a protein supplement or a sports drink on changes in lean muscle mass in young adults who were treated for childhood cancer. The sports drink, for this study, is considered a placebo.

NCT ID: NCT02499861 Completed - Cancer Clinical Trials

Phase I/II a Study of Decitabine in Combination With Genistein in Pediatric Relapsed or Refractory Malignancies

Start date: July 2015
Phase: Phase 1/Phase 2
Study type: Interventional

This Phase I/IIa study will test the combination of the epigenetic drug decitabine with the isoflavone genistein in children with leukemias and solid tumors. For the phase I study, the maximum tolerated dose will be evaluated in pediatric patients with relapsed or refractory leukemia and solid tumors. For the phase II study, only patients with relapsed or refractory leukemias will be included. To further evaluate the treatment efficacy and gain further insight into action of these drugs, the DNA methylation levels before and after treatment for all participants, pharmacokinetics parameters such as through level for decitabine and through and peak level for genistein will be measured. Pharmacogenomics testing for decitabine will be performed prior to cycle 1 of treatment. Decitabine will be administered over a 24 hours infusion on day 1 of cycle (28 days) and genistein will be taken orally twice daily from day 2 to 21, followed by a 7 days rest period.

NCT ID: NCT02489799 Completed - Cancer Clinical Trials

Utilizing Advance Care Planning Videos to Empower Perioperative Cancer Patients and Families

ACPvideo
Start date: July 2015
Phase: N/A
Study type: Interventional

Through close engagement with our patient and family member co-investigators, the investigators have developed a video-based advance care planning aid for cancer patients and their family members who are preparing for major surgery. In this study, patients are randomized to see either the intervention video (involving advance care planning-related content) or a control video (no advance care planning-related content) prior to surgery. The investigators hypothesize that the video will lead to more and better preoperative discussions between the patient and surgeon that are related to advance care planning. The investigators also hypothesize that seeing the advance care planning-related video will decrease perioperative anxiety and depression scores.
